Transaction

117b75c670be9d730848fcbb6e8d71d1aef2fcd01ae593108ba5cbfa53a9c29c
399,454 confirmations
Timestamp
1536004578
Block539,824
Fee4,548 sats
Fee rate23.7 sats/vB
view on mempool.space

Inputs & Outputs